As to using playlists, the database, and playing music, this is covered in the manual. You can still use iTunes to sync, but you won't be able to access the songs easily through the "Files" view, only by way of the database, and only for non-encrypted audio.

The database has nothing to do with iTunes, otherwise the manual would mention needing to use iTunes with it. It just depends on your files having the appropriate metadata (ID3 tags for MP3s).
